A sporting goods store has sold 65% of its inventory of a popular brand of basketball shoes.

If the store sold 166 pairs of basketball shoes, how many pairs did it have to begin with? Round your answer to the nearest whole number.

Let the total number of pairs of basketball shoes the store had initially be represented as \( x \).

According to the problem, the store has sold 65% of its inventory, which can be expressed mathematically as:

\[ 0.65x = 166 \]

To find \( x \), we divide both sides of the equation by 0.65:

\[ x = \frac{166}{0.65} \]

Calculating the right side:

\[ x \approx 255.38 \]

Rounding to the nearest whole number:

\[ x \approx 255 \]

Therefore, the store originally had approximately 255 pairs of basketball shoes.
